is it possible to have two separate joomla installations (essentially 2 joomla sites) on one domain? i.e. the main http://www.____.com would take you to a splash page with 2 links/options, and from there each link would take you to http://www.____.com/siteone and http://www.____.com/sitetwo .

is this possible? if so, how is it done?

Yes, just use two separate directories to install under the root - I would use a subdomain to refer to the directory (if I were in your shoes)

I have done this, two separate joomla installations in two different subdirectories.

However I think they sometimes conflict and I get an "Invalid Token" error which I suspect is due to cookies colliding?
